LSM6DSV16B 6-Axis IMU with Sensor Fusion
STMicroelectronics' SiP IMU features a 3-axis digital accelerometer and a 3-axis digital gyroscope
 STMicroelectronics' LSM6DSV16B is a system-in-package (SiP) inertial measurement unit (IMU) featuring a 3-axis digital accelerometer and a 3-axis digital gyroscope with dual channels for processing acceleration and angular rate sensing data for motion tracking (user interface, device power management, 3D head tracking for gaming, and an enhanced audio experience) as well as vibration detection for bone conduction on separate channels with dedicated configuration, processing, and filtering.

The motion tracking in high-performance mode runs at 0.6 mA and enables always-on low-power features for an optimal motion experience. The LSM6DSV16B embeds advanced dedicated features and data processing for motion processing like the finite state machine (FSM), sensor fusion low power (SFLP), and adaptive self-configuration (ASC).
The LSM6DSV16B integrates a 6-axis IMU sensor with audio accelerometer features in a compact package (2.5 mm x 3.0 mm x 0.71 mm).
- Dual channels for motion tracking and bone conduction
- Power consumption: 0.95 mA in combo high-performance mode
- Always-on experience with low power consumption for both accelerometer and gyroscope
- Smart FIFO up to 4.5 KB
- ±2/±4/±8/±16 g full scale
- ±125/±250/±500/±1,000/±2,000/±4,000 dps full scale
- 3-axis audio accelerometer with flat and wide bandwidth >1 kHz and low noise 20 μg/√Hz
- SPI/I²C and MIPI I3C® v1.1 serial interface with main processor data synchronization
- TDM secondary interface
- Advanced pedometer, step detector, and step counter
- Significant motion detection, tilt detection
- Standard interrupts: free-fall, wakeup, 6D orientation, click and double-click
- Programmable finite state machine for accelerometer, gyroscope, and external sensor data processing with high rate at 960 Hz
- Embedded adaptive self-configuration (ASC)
- Embedded sensor fusion low-power algorithm
- Embedded temperature sensor
- Analog supply voltage: 1.71 V to 3.6 V
- Independent IO supply (extended range: 1.08 V to 3.6 V)
- Compact footprint: 2.5 mm x 3 mm x 0.71 mm
- ECOPACK and RoHS compliant
